The distance from Florence to Vienna is approximately 393 miles (633 km).
The average frequency per day from Florence to Vienna is:
  • Around 23 flights per day.
  • Around 14 buses per day.
  • Around 4 trains per day.

However, we recommend checking specific travel dates for your route between Florence and Vienna as scheduled services by train, bus, and flight can vary by season or day of the week.

These are the most popular departure and arrival points from Florence to Vienna:
  • Flights mostly depart from Florence Peretola Airport and arrive in Vienna International Airport.
  • Trains mostly depart from Florence Santa Maria Novella and arrive in Vienna Hbf.
  • Buses mostly depart from Scandicci, Villa Costanza (Florence) and arrive in Vienna, International Busterminal (VIB).
